Birmingham Criminal Defense Attorney

Mr. Ingram is a native of Birmingham, Alabama. After earning his Bachelor’s Degree from Samford University, he worked for Alabama Power in Corporate Accounting. Mr. Ingram earned his law degree from Birmingham School of Law in 2002. While attending law school, Mr. Ingram worked as a law clerk in the Office of District Attorney for the Tenth Judicial Circuit in Jefferson County, Alabama. He has also served as an Assistant District Attorney in Baldwin County, Alabama, and was chosen to be a panel member of the Criminal Justice Act panel for the Northern District of Alabama. Mr. Ingram frequently handles cases in all Federal District Courts in Alabama and throughout the Southeast.

Experience

Mr. Ingram has successfully handled cases in the areas of criminal conspiracy, drug trafficking, federal firearms violations, tax fraud, mail fraud, wire fraud, aggravated identity theft, child pornography, illegal reentry, felon in possession of firearms, counterfeiting, bank robbery, pharmacy robbery, credit card counterfeiting/fraud, and computer crimes.

Mr. Ingram has also represented numerous professionals before their licensing boards, including The Alabama Pharmacy Board, The Alabama Board of Medical Examiners, The Alabama Nursing Board, The Alabama Dental Board, and The Alabama Chiropractic Board.

Mr. Ingram has extensive experience in civil and divorce cases that involve complex financial issues where substantial assets are at risk. His accounting background has allowed him to protect the interests of numerous clients who find themselves involved in business torts and contract litigation.

Mr. Ingram is a member of the Alabama State Bar, The Birmingham Bar Association, The Alabama Criminal Defense Lawyers Association, the Greater Birmingham Criminal Defense Lawyers Association, and the Legal Fraternal Organization of Sigma Delta Kappa.
